SRX2190421: Whole genome sequencing of C. lanienae strain RM6987
1 ILLUMINA (Illumina MiSeq) run: 369,629 spots, 90.8M bases, 47.6Mb downloads

Design: Illumina libraries were prepared for all strains using the KAPA Low-Throughput Library Preparation Kit with Standard PCR Amplification Module (Kapa Biosystems, Wilmington, MA), following manufacturer's instructions except for the following changes: 750 ng DNA was sheared at 30 psi for 40 s and size selected to 700-770 bp following Illumina protocols. Standard desalting TruSeq LT and PCR Primers were ordered from Integrated DNA Technologies (Coralville, IA) and used at 0.375 and 0.5 ľM final concentrations, respectively. PCR was reduced to 3-5 cycles. Libraries were quantified using the KAPA Library Quantification Kit (Kapa), except with 10 ľl volume and 90-s annealing/extension PCR, then pooled and normalized to 4 nM. Pooled libraries were requantified by ddPCR on a QX200 system (Bio-Rad), using the Illumina TruSeq ddPCR Library Quantification Kit and following manufacturer's protocols, except with an extended 2-min annealing/extension time. The libraries were sequenced 2 × 250 bp paired end v2 on a MiSeq instrument (Illumina) at 13.5 pM, following manufacturer's protocols.
